Q&A Friday: Ann Barlow

By admin

Ann Barlow is partner and president of Peppercom San Francisco.  She is the founder of GreenPepper, Peppercom’s environmental offering.

Q. How did you get your start in PR?
A. I actually majored in public relations, which at that time meant designing my own major through the University of Illinois’ college of liberal arts. When I graduated, I moved to New York and started with a small agency.

Q. You lead GreenPepper.  What has been the most important thing you’ve learned in that endeavor?
A. You have to surround yourself with people who know more about environmental issues than you, and then read as much as you can.  This is an area of expertise that you just can’t fake.

Q. What qualities make a young PR professional stand out to you?
A. Initiative, good listening and learning ability, and organization.

Q. What one piece of advice do you have for those just starting their careers in PR?
A. Have an ownership mentality.  In other words, always be looking to see what else you can do to make a project and the company successful.  Do your work as if it was going directly to the client, so make it as high quality as possible.  Let others come to rely on you, and you’ll be successful.
